Organic bedding
When we start looking at our lifestyles with a more critical eye, one realisation likely to cause a stir is the level of chemicals we are exposed to while we sleep. This makes organic bedding a perfect solution.
Organic bedding is increasingly becoming an absolute essential for many 'Organics', but exactly why is it necessary? Some may consider it a step too far - but there are in fact very good reasons for the trend.
For example, organic bedding contains none of the pesticides used in the production of natural fibres such as cotton, while non-organic bedding, which does contain these pesticides, is also treated with chemical based dyes or flame retardants (for nylon duvets).
More disturbing though, is the fact that 'easycare' fabrics (usually polyster or polyester/cotton blends) are often finished with a formaldehyde resin that gives them their 'easycare' feature.
As the resin degenerates over time, the formaldehyde is released as a vapour - exposure to which can result in symptoms such as headaches, respiratory problems and skin rashes.
A worrying thought when you consider that we spend about one third of our lives in bed!
Organic bedding can offer not only a peaceful night's sleep, but peace of mind, as it contains none of the chemical resins or residues left over from growth or production.
